About this property
Fisherman`s cottage close to Looe`s harbour
Jessamine Cottage is a fully restored former fisherman`s cottage located in the heart of West Looe. The cottage dates back some 300 years and is arranged over 3 floors. Sleeping 7 (2 x doubles, 1 x single & 1 bunk bed), it is perfect for both smaller and larger families alike as well as couples. Renovation work included a full back-to-bricks rebuild programme, replacing floors, walls, windows and doors.
The house is equipped to a very high standard including high-quality bed linen and towels. Guests will appreciate the attention to detail. The house has the benefit of an allocated parking space in the Millpool carpark (a 6 - 7 minute walk) as well as wifi broadband.
Joining instructions are usually sent out 2 - 3 weeks before arrival. Guests can normally access the house from 5.00 pm on the first day, although we will our best to get you in well before this. We ask that your accommodation be vacated by 9.00 am on the day of departure. Unfortunately, our cleaning company dictates these times, although we will do our very best to extend these.
The house is less than a two minute walk from Looe`s bustling harbour and the ferry to East Looe. It is also ideally positioned close to the coastal footpath to Talland, Polperro, Lantic Bay, Polruan and Fowey.
Looe can be accessed by car or public transport. The town`s train station is less than fifteen minutes away by foot or just a few minutes by taxi.
There is a layby opposite the house that can be used to unload and load, and if this is occupied, there should be nearby parking at the bottom of North Road or on the quayside. Maximum number of guests in the house is 7.
